The sound of the Glazier's voice wrapping its way around her name made her smile. Things were right and as they should be. Grumpy as Duchanar may have been when she first stumbled upon him, it was the luckiest of the events that could have transpired. She didn't know it then or now, but she knew that she was happy with what had become of the short time she had spent here in Helovia. Gods. As the grullo stallion spoke of the immortals she flicked her ears to and fro slightly. She knew little of them, other than they existed, but now was not the time for such conversations.

The watchful eye of the grullo stallion upon her did not unnerve her, though perhaps it should have. And Thor's silence and brooding, though unnatural to him, was all she had known of him and she could only assume it was his natural state. If she could have understood the history between the pair she spoke with her heart would have been heavy. She wasn't meant for such sorrows, though. Even if she had asked she would not have understood the depth of the emotions between to two of them. Her feelings were often so fleeting, even the memories of the loss of her parents and twin brother came and went so suddenly. Philosophizing just wasn't in her nature, or in the course the stars had set out for her.

Critical information. The words of her king caused her to turn her head to look at him. His words intrigued her. She had known that magic must be involved in the crafters' duties somehow, to create a wall was no small task after all, but the idea of herself gaining magic hadn't exactly crossed her mind. To be like a mare from a fairytale, like almost every horse she had seen since entering Helovia, was enticing to her and only strengthened her resolve. This was her course in her new found life. She was certain. Now, upon the words of the Glazier, she just had to put her thoughts into words.
How come I chose the edge? Dreams and hopes? Oh, there is plenty to talk about, isn't there. But we won't go into the whole story. That may be a little too much information.
“You've been nothing but a perfect host, Thor,” she smiled kindly. Gentle Heart could not have been a clearer description and she would not soon forget the hospitality she had been shown in coming here. Turning back to Lace, then, she began to address his questions. “Ah, ask all the questions you will, my friend. This is your home and I've come into it so suddenly.” His concerns were warranted, of course. She could respect that. “I can't imagine a reason I would have said no to an offer to live here. Duchanar found me in the Threshold, Thor welcomed me so kindly at the borders. Duchanar and Thor also briefly mentioned the Dragon Heart and the work she does to maintain this land for you- us.” She paused for a moment thinking back to some of Duchanar's first words when they came to the border of the Edge. “They called this a family. I want to be a part of that.” It was subtle, but her voice had changed just ever so slightly at these last two sentences. They were some of the most honest and heart-felt words she had spoken. Her prior words had all been truth, of course, but some thoughts come from the heart more than the brain.

“I must admit, the Glazier trade was a more sudden realization. In coming to the borders we had seen a mare with some sort of charm or trinket about her neck...” She trailed off momentarily before picking up with a somewhat different thought. “If I am to call the Edge home and the Qian family then I want to be useful to them. I don't desire to be a burden on the herd or useless addition simply to raise numbers.” It was all truth- the little part about her ambition for power was simply left out. Not a lie, an omission. “I'm no warrior, though, and I'm afraid I'll never be a philosopher. I suppose I could heal... but to add more beauty to the world by creating...” She trailed off, unsure how to finish the sentiment, although the intent of her sentence was likely clear. Her thoughts and words were scattered, but she was no liar. She didn't have the skills for it. She could only hope now that she had explained herself well enough for the grullo stallion and Thor. In wandering alone for a year she had not be asked to explain her feelings and she was somewhat out of practice.
